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are found in a variety of newer vehicles. Although they may appear more complicated than a typical mechanical key, they can provide numerous advantages to car owners. They can reduce the risk of auto theft by requiring a unique code to turn on the vehicle. The car's computer will only be able to be able to read this code if the key is turned on and inserted into the ignition.

To do this, a transponder keys is equipped with a microchip that transmits the radio signal at a low level when the key is activated. The car's computer is able to detect the code once the signal reaches. It then determines whether the key is genuine. If it is it is, the car will allow it to start. If not, the vehicle will not respond and refuse to turn off.

Transponder keys are made for specific cars, making it very difficult for hackers or thieves to duplicate their keys. This has led to a decrease in auto theft rates worldwide in recent years.
